K 10 svn:author V 6 adrian K 8 svn:date V 27 2014-05-10T00:53:36.839154Z K 7 svn:log V 988 Add in support to optionally pin the swi threads. Under enough load, the swi's can actually be preempted and migrated to other currently free cores. When doing RSS experiments, this lead to the per-CPU TCP timers not lining up any more with the RX CPU said flows were ending up on, leading to increased lock contention. Since there was a little pushback on flipping them on by default, I've left the default at "don't pin." The other less obvious problem here is that the default swi is also the same as the destination swi for CPU #0. So if one pins the swi on CPU #0, there's no default floating swi. A nice future project would be to create a separate swi for the "default" floating swi, as well as per-CPU swis that are (optionally) pinned. Tested: * parallel TCP tests (2 x 1g unfortunately for now); CPU: Intel(R) Xeon(R) CPU E5-2650 Note: This is based on some initial investigation into RSS/TCP stack lock contention on FreeBSD-HEAD whilst at Netflix in January 2014.
